    Ever wished you had white skin? Shaniera Akram has a message for you

    Let’s be honest – we’ve all dealt with the gora complex at some point in our lives and have used countless totkas to get flawless, fair skin. Turns out, white girls have a similar complex and Shaniera Akram in a recent post opened up about her struggle as a white girl wanting tanned, brown skin.

    “To all the girls with brown skin wishing they had white, I just want to let you know that there are a hell of a lot of white girls who grew up wishing they had dark skin too, I know I was one of them,” she wrote.

    She continued, “We thought that if our skin was brown we looked healthier, prettier and more attractive to boys. We would go to any length to change the colour of white to brown because that what was instilled in our minds, that brown was more beautiful.”

    Concluding her note, Akram said, “What I’m trying to say is don’t try and change who you are, be happy underneath your skin, your beauty is interpreted by you, you are beautiful no matter what your skin colour is!”

    Shaniera Akram’s shoot for ‘Money Back Guarantee’ was full of drama

    Shaniera Akram is making her movie debut and that too in Faisal Qureshi’s star-studded venture Money Back Guarantee. The star lineup also includes her husband Wasim Akram, Fawad Khan, Mikaal Zulfiqar, Gohar Rasheed and Kiran Malik.

    In an Instagram post, Shaniera talked about working on Money Back Guarantee and how her 12 days on set included a “sprained ankle, a bathroom lock-in, a painful tetanus shot, sleepless nights, loads of Lays Masala chips, language barriers to the next level, a romantic moment and an unforgettable chandelier stunt” that gave her “an out of body experience.”

    The shoot for Money Back Guarantee has wrapped up and the film is eyeing an Eid ul Fitr release. The film, reported to be a satirical comedy, was shot in Karachi, Lahore and Houston.

    Shaniera Akram urges people to not visit Clifton Beach

    Shaniera Akram may have moved to Pakistan after she married cricket legend Wasim Akram, but she’s made a strong mark in the country, being a more responsible citizen than any of us. Shaniera is often seen working towards social causes be it for children, animals or for the environment. Shaniera has now used her voice to highlight the terrible condition of Karachi’s Clifton Beach.

    Taking to social media, Shaniera posted several pictures and videos of the beach littered with medical waste, syringes, and vials of blood, calling on authorities to close down the beach for the public until it is safe.

    “I have walked on Clifton beach every day for the last 4 years and I have never been scared until today. This beach needs to be shut down now,” Shaniera asserted.

    Shaniera urged Karachiites to abstain from visiting and cleaning the beach since it is hazardous for the people.

    Following Shaniera’s protest and outrage on Twitter, the Sindh Police took to social media to announce that the police have cordoned off the affected area and imposed Section 144.
